Snivy worth
Legendary Treasures · #6 · Common · Updated Aug 5, 2026
$0.29
Live raw market estimate · PSA 10 n/a
Current market prices
| TCGplayer market | $0.29 |
| Cardmarket low | €0.47 (~$0.54) |
| TCGplayer mid | $0.28 |
| PSA 10 (eBay median) | - |
Buy / comps: TCGplayer · eBay sold · Cardmarket
Sale price history
Stable near $0.29 across 9 days on record.
Snivy, the Grass-type Pokémon, makes its appearance as card number 6 in the Legendary Treasures set, charming fans with its playful design by artist Aya Kusube. This card is part of a series that celebrates the vibrant world of Pokémon, encapsulating the essence of the franchise in a collectible format. While classified as a common card, Snivy's appeal lies in its connection to both the game and the animated series, making it a sought-after item for collectors.
